Summary
Eberhard Schockenhoff is a human[1]. His place of birth was Stuttgart[2]. He was born on March 29, 1953[3]. He died in Freiburg im Breisgau[4]. He died on July 18, 2020[5]. He worked as a theologian[6], university teacher[7], and Catholic priest[8].
